Impressed
I've been using this for several months now and I'm very happy with it.I'm mostly using it in a hot smoker, so the dual probes has been important to me. I use one for the temperature of the meat and one for the temperature of the air in the smoker.The wireless range is excellent. I can have the probes in my back yard and the main unit at the farthest point inside my house and there has been no issues at all with connecting.You can set a target temperature range and it will alarm when going either above or below this range. This is great for cooking at the right rate and being able to pull it out at the right time.There's only 2 issues that I have with it.First, the controls are cumbersome to set the temperature range. You can figure out how the set the meat temperature range fairly quickly by pushing a few buttons, but I always have trouble setting the oven temperature range. I keep having to pull out the instructions and figure it out. Totally not intuitive, but usable once you figure it out.The second is that it'd be nice to be able to just turn off the alarm sound. When triggered, you can push a button to make it stop, but the next time it goes into range then back out of range it will start beeping again. For example I might be monitoring from a distance, chatting with people. Then I'll go to open the smoker and adjust something. I know the oven temp is going to drop below the target when I do this, so it's going to start beeping away until someone pushes the button. Sometimes just flashing with no sound would be better.Otherwise I'm super happy with this. It does everything I want and was a great price.

Works, but care needs to be taken on first assembly
Hopefully the manufacturer reads this, I received my unit with a similar flaw others reported with the lens ready to pop off. As someone who design products, there is a simple adjustment in manufacturing that needs to be made to resolve. For others that experienced this, there is a tab to pull off a protective clear sheet, but the tab is actually more bonded to the lens than the sheet it’s trying to remove. The glue under this lens releases in turn. So if you start pulling to remove, simply stop, actually rub the tab more into the lens. This will do 2 things, start creating an air gap between the protective sheet and the lens, and also tighten the bond the the tab and protective sheet. It also tightens the bond with the lens and the plastic body.So far I’ve checked and it connects correctly and appears to be initially accurate. I’ve only experienced real time tracking of temp while cooking recently but it certainly beat stabbing your food every 2 minutes and lowering the cooking temp in the process.
